Apple lowers app store fees for small developers, critics say move has little impact

Apple Inc mentioned on Wednesday it plans to begin a program to decrease its App Store commissions for software program builders who make $1 million or much less in proceeds annually from the shop, however a few of the firm’s critics known as the transfer “window dressing.”

Apple takes a 30% lower of most purchases made on the App Store, though the fee drops to 15% for subscriptions that stay lively for greater than a yr.

The iPhone maker mentioned builders will routinely get the decrease 15% charge in the event that they generate $1 million or much less in proceeds – outlined because the portion of retailer purchases that the developer retains – in a calendar yr.

Apple’s App Store charges and guidelines have come beneath fireplace from massive corporations similar to Microsoft Corp, Spotify Technology SA, Match Group Inc and Epic Games in addition to startups and smaller firms that allege the charges deprive shoppers of decisions and push up the value of apps.

“This would be something to celebrate were it not a calculated move by Apple to divide app creators and preserve their monopoly on stores and payments, again breaking the promise of treating all developers equally,” Epic Games Chief Executive Officer Tim Sweeney mentioned.

In reply to its critics, the iPhone maker has beforehand mentioned its guidelines apply evenly to builders and that the App Store supplies a straightforward strategy to attain its large base of customers with out having to arrange fee methods within the 175 international locations the place it operates.

The transfer will have an effect on a broad swath of builders, however it was unclear how large the monetary affect could be for Apple.

Based on the publishers it tracks, analytics agency Sensor Tower mentioned 97.5% of iOS builders generated lower than $1 million per yr in gross shopper spending. But those self same builders contributed solely 4.9% of the App Store’s 2019 income.

However, Gene Munster of Loupe Ventures, a longtime Apple analyst, estimated the small builders lined beneath this system make up 20% of Apple’s App retailer income. He lowered his estimate for Apple’s retailer income in its subsequent fiscal yr to $14.2 billion, a $1.6 billion discount from his estimate earlier than the coverage change and about 0.5% of Apple’s general income.

The App Association, a gaggle sponsored by Apple, mentioned in an announcement that the “reduced commission for small businesses will allow them to put additional resources towards scaling up and innovating new products and services.”

In an announcement, Match Group mentioned Apple’s guidelines nonetheless pressured builders to make use of its fee system even when Apple competes towards these builders. “And if you manage to grow your revenue over $1 million, they then double their cut – arbitrarily – making it even harder for the startup to continue to grow,” the corporate mentioned.

Spotify, which is pursuing an antitrust criticism towards Apple in Europe, mentioned in an announcement that it hopes “regulators will ignore Apple’s ‘window dressing’ and act with urgency to protect consumer choice, ensure fair competition, and create a level playing field for all,”

Apple mentioned the brand new program will begin on Jan. 1 and it’ll give extra particulars on which builders qualify subsequent month.
